Game summary
The Chicago Bears beat the San Francisco 49ers 14–9 on 2018-12-23, overcoming San Francisco 49ers's 9–7 halftime lead. Mitchell Trubisky posted a game-high +7.20 total EPA in the passing.
The highest-scoring period was Q2 with 16 combined points.

Drive & efficiency notes
Despite the final score, Chicago Bears generated the better offensive EPA per play (-0.01 vs -0.11), suggesting they moved the ball more efficiently.
Season benchmark context (offensive EPA per play):
- Chicago Bears: -0.01 EPA/play (47th percentile vs. 2018 team-game averages)
- San Francisco 49ers: -0.11 EPA/play (25th percentile vs. 2018 team-game averages)
- Chicago Bears: 9 drives, -0.92 total EPA, 2 scoring drives
- San Francisco 49ers: 9 drives, -7.63 total EPA, 3 scoring drives
